JPEG is technically an acronym for Joint Photographic Experts Group, the committee that created the JPEG compression standard for digitized photographic images.[1] However, JPEG is commonly used JPEG in reference to images compressed with the compression algorithm specified in JPEG standards. JPEG images are usually compressed using a lossy compression algorithm, but lossless JPEG compression is also specified.
